What is Hypertension?
Hypertension, also known as high blood pressure, is a condition where the blood pressure levels rise above the normal range of 120/80 mmHg. This condition can vary slightly based on age and other factors, but consistent elevated blood pressure readings are required for a diagnosis. Hypertension can be caused by several factors including stress, diet, and genetics. When left untreated, it can lead to severe complications such as heart disease, stroke, and kidney failure.

What is Hyperthyroidism?
Hyperthyroidism is a metabolic disorder in which the thyroid gland produces excessive amounts of thyroxine, a hormone responsible for regulating the body’s metabolism. This overproduction of thyroxine speeds up various bodily functions, leading to a variety of symptoms. The condition can be caused by factors such as Graves’ disease, thyroid nodules, or inflammation of the thyroid.

What is Hypothyroidism?
Hypothyroidism is a metabolic disorder in which the thyroid gland produces an insufficient amount of thyroxine, a hormone that plays a key role in regulating metabolism. When the thyroid does not produce enough of this hormone, the body’s metabolic processes slow down, leading to a variety of symptoms. This condition can result from factors like autoimmune diseases (e.g., Hashimoto’s thyroiditis), iodine deficiency, or thyroid surgery.

What is Jaundice?
Jaundice refers to the yellowish discoloration of the skin, mucous membranes, and the whites of the eyes (sclera) caused by the accumulation of bilirubin in the blood. Bilirubin, a yellow pigment produced during the breakdown of red blood cells, can accumulate due to improper metabolism or excretion, leading to jaundice. This condition is commonly associated with liver disorders, gallbladder issues, or hemolysis (destruction of red blood cells).

What are Kidney Stones?
Kidney stones are hard deposits of minerals and salts that form inside the kidneys when there is improper excretion of waste materials through urine. These stones can range in size from tiny sand-like particles to large, grapefruit-sized masses. Kidney stone formation can cause intense pain, bleeding during urination, and sometimes even pain while at rest. The primary cause is the buildup of minerals like calcium, oxalate, uric acid, and phosphate in the kidneys.

What is Vitiligo?
Vitiligo (also known as Leucoderma) is a skin condition characterized by the gradual loss of melanin pigment from certain areas of the skin, resulting in white patches or depigmentation. This occurs when the body’s immune system mistakenly attacks and destroys the pigment-producing cells (melanocytes) in the skin. The condition can affect any part of the body, including the face, hands, and even hair (leading to premature greying).

Osteoarthritis is a degenerative joint disease caused by the gradual breakdown of cartilage—the protective tissue between bones. This leads to joint pain, swelling, stiffness, and restricted mobility. It most commonly affects the knees, hips, hands, and spine, severely impacting daily activities and quality of life.
🧬 As we age, the wear and tear on joints increases, but poor lifestyle, injuries, or obesity can accelerate degeneration.

Paralysis refers to the partial or complete loss of motor and sensory function in one or more parts of the body. It can be temporary or permanent, and often results from neurological damage due to conditions such as:
- Stroke
- Spinal cord injury
- Brain trauma
- Neurological disorders
Depending on the severity and the affected region, paralysis may involve a single limb, one side of the body (hemiplegia), or the entire body (quadriplegia/paraplegia).

A slip disc, also known as a herniated disc or prolapsed disc, is a spinal condition where a tear in the outer fibrous ring of an intervertebral disc allows the soft inner material to bulge out. This bulge can compress nearby nerves, leading to pain, numbness, and mobility issues.
Most commonly, it affects the lumbar spine (lower back) but may also occur in the cervical region.
